top fuel car
Top fuel cars are super-fast racing cars used in drag racing. They have very powerful engines that help them go from zero to very high speeds in just a few seconds.
A top fuel car is a type of drag racing vehicle that is designed for maximum speed and acceleration. These cars are powered by supercharged engines that can produce over 10,000 horsepower, allowing them to complete a quarter-mile in less than four seconds.
